Huawei’s various FreeBuds headphones have new audio functions

According to the information, a variety of FreeBuds headphones and smart glasses getting a new feature update, which adds support for audio service cards and application broadcasts.

Feature 1: Audio Service Card
In the form of a shortcut, the audio connection center is directly added to the mobile phone desktop, and the headset can be quickly switched between multiple devices with one touch!

Applicable Products:

HUAWEI FreeBuds 4, HUAWEI FreeBuds 4E, HUAWEI FreeBuds Pro, HUAWEI FreeBuds Lipstick, FreeBuds Studio, Huawei Smart Glasses.

How to set it up:

1. Update first!

* Huawei mobile phone/tablet needs to be upgraded to HarmonyOS 2.0 and above;

* Open HUAWEI AppGallery, click My → Update Management, click Audio Manager and Smart Life App in the update list to update (not in the list means it is the latest version).

2. After completing the update:

Method 1: Connect the headset, Settings→Bluetooth Settings→Audio Service Card→Add to Desktop

Method 2: Connect the headset, Smart Life App → Headphone Card Page → Audio Service Card → Add to Desktop

Function 2: Quick reminder – application broadcast
After turning it on, you can “hear” the latest news anytime, anywhere without picking up your phone! Chat messages (you can also remind if there are red envelopes), takeaways, taxis, etc., important information is not omitted!

Applicable Products:

HUAWEI FreeBuds 3, HUAWEI FreeBuds 4, HUAWEI FreeBuds 4i, HUAWEI FreeBuds 4E, HUAWEI FreeBuds Pro, HUAWEI FreeBudsLipstick, HUAWEI FreeBuds Studio, HUAWEI Smart Glasses.

How to set it up:

1, or update first!

* Huawei mobile phone/tablet needs to be upgraded to HarmonyOS 2.0 and above;

* Open HUAWEI AppGallery, click My → Update Management, and click Audio Manager and Smart Life App in the update list to update (not in the list means it is the latest version).

2. After completing the update:

Connect the headset, Smart Life App → Headphone Card Page → Quick Reminder → App Notification Broadcasting → Click Authorization → Select the application you want to broadcast, and choose to enable important notification broadcast or all notification broadcast according to your needs

Possible reasons for setting but not broadcasting

The phone/tablet is in the unlocked and bright screen state;

Do not disturb mode is enabled on the phone/tablet;

The app that needs to be broadcast does not have the message notification permission;

A group chat or contact is set to do not disturb.

PS. If the Smart Life App has been updated, but the setting entry of “Audio Service Card” or “Quick Reminder” is still not displayed, you can close the Smart Life App and reopen it.

The FreeBuds Pro headset is being tested in version 576, and the update page shows HarmonyOS 2.1.0.576.
